Bithumb, the leading cryptocurrency exchange in South Korea, is about to face significant regulatory consequences as the nation’s financial regulator prepares to levy substantial penalties for breaches of an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) rules. The Financial Intelligence Unit (FIU) has wrapped up a year-long round of on-site audits at major exchanges such as Bithumb, Coinone, Korbit, and GOPAX, and is now proceeding to the stage of issuing fines. This enforcement comes on the heels of a similar action against Dunamu, the company behind Upbit, which was hit with a $26 million fine in February for compliance failures. Industry observers expect Bithumb and other exchanges to receive penalties

, with possible sanctions ranging from operational limitations to monetary fines.

The XRP ecosystem is also making inroads into the traditional financial sector. Three spot XRP exchange-traded funds (ETFs) are expected to launch soon, with Grayscale and Franklin Templeton joining 21Shares in providing access to the token. According to Bloomberg analyst James Seyffart, Grayscale’s XRP ETF is slated to go live on November 24, while 21Shares’ TOXR ticker will be listed on the Cboe BZX exchange.
